One of the CONCACAF World Cup qualifying fixtures will take place on Friday at the Franklin Essed Stadium in Paramaribo, where Suriname will host the national team of El Salvador. Let’s break down this matchup, where the hosts have every chance to extend their unbeaten run.

Match preview

Suriname come into this game as Group A leaders, showcasing impressive form as they chase a historic first-ever World Cup appearance. The team has gone four matches unbeaten, drawing three times and securing a win over this very opponent in September. Their recent clash with Panama was especially telling—Suriname let victory slip away late, but still kept their hopes of topping the group alive.

Despite a modest number of wins, the squad displays organized and determined football, relying on solid defense and efficient attacking play. The upcoming match is crucial, as the final round will see them travel to Guatemala, so a win over El Salvador would strengthen Suriname’s grip on a direct qualification spot.

El Salvador find themselves in a tough spot, having suffered three consecutive losses after an opening win against Guatemala. All defeats came by a single goal, highlighting their gritty but ultimately unsuccessful battles. Their latest match ended in a home disaster (0-1) against Guatemala, leaving the team on the brink of elimination from the qualifiers.

This trip to Paramaribo is the visitors’ last chance to stay in the race. Only a win will keep their hopes alive for direct qualification or at least a spot in the intercontinental playoffs. Under pressure and needing to attack, El Salvador will have to open up—something that could play into the hands of an organized Suriname side.
